Using Skype in China?
Just a quick note that if you’re using Skype in China, or more importantly, using a TOM-Skype (from skype.tom.com) download of the software, you should check out my most recent post on Lost Laowai: Chinese Skype privacy breech. If you are, or have chatted to anyone using the Chinese-version of Skype, there’s a good chance your conversations were searched for keywords and saved on a server that was found to be publicly accessible.
